最近项目中用到的加密方式
1 public class DesEncrypt 2 { 3 private static readonly byte[] _Key = ASCIIEncoding.ASCII.GetBytes("MDAPPDES"); 4 private static readonly string _MD5_Key = "MDAPPMD5"; 5 6 /// <summary> 7 /// DES加密字符串 8 /// </summary> 9 /// <param name="encryptString">待加密的字符串</param> 10 /// <param name="Key">密钥</param> 11 /// <returns>加密成功返回加密后的字符串,失败返回源串</returns> 12 public static string EncryptDES(string encryptString) 13 { 14 try 15 { 16 byte[] Key = _Key; 17 byte[] inputByteArray = Encoding.UTF8.GetBytes(encryptString); 18 DESCryptoServiceProvider des = new DESCryptoServiceProvider(); 19 des.Key = Key; 20 des.Mode = CipherMode.ECB; 21 MemoryStream mStream = new MemoryStream(); 22 CryptoStream cStream = new CryptoStream(mStream, des.CreateEncryptor(), CryptoStreamMode.Write); 23 cStream.Write(inputByteArray, 0, inputByteArray.Length); 24 cStream.FlushFinalBlock(); 25 return Convert.ToBase64String(mStream.ToArray()); 26 } 27 catch 28 { 29 throw; 30 } 31 } 32 33 /// <summary> 34 /// DES解密字符串 35 /// </summary> 36 /// <param name="decryptString">待解密的字符串</param> 37 /// <returns>解密成功返回解密后的字符串,失败返源串</returns> 38 public static string DecryptDES(string decryptString) 39 { 40 try 41 { 42 byte[] Key = _Key; 43 byte[] inputByteArray = Convert.FromBase64String(decryptString); 44 DESCryptoServiceProvider des = new DESCryptoServiceProvider(); 45 des.Key = Key; 46 des.Mode = CipherMode.ECB; 47 MemoryStream mStream = new MemoryStream(); 48 CryptoStream cStream = new CryptoStream(mStream, des.CreateDecryptor(), CryptoStreamMode.Write); 49 cStream.Write(inputByteArray, 0, inputByteArray.Length); 50 cStream.FlushFinalBlock(); 51 return Encoding.UTF8.GetString(mStream.ToArray()); 52 } 53 catch 54 { 55 throw; 56 } 57 } 58 59 ///MD5加密 60 public static string EncryptMD5(string pToEncrypt) 61 { 62 DESCryptoServiceProvider des = new DESCryptoServiceProvider(); 63 byte[] inputByteArray = Encoding.Default.GetBytes(pToEncrypt); 64 des.Key = ASCIIEncoding.ASCII.GetBytes(_MD5_Key); 65 des.IV = ASCIIEncoding.ASCII.GetBytes(_MD5_Key); 66 MemoryStream ms = new MemoryStream(); 67 CryptoStream cs = new CryptoStream(ms, des.CreateEncryptor(), CryptoStreamMode.Write); 68 cs.Write(inputByteArray, 0, inputByteArray.Length); 69 cs.FlushFinalBlock(); 70 StringBuilder ret = new StringBuilder(); 71 foreach (byte b in ms.ToArray()) 72 { 73 ret.AppendFormat("{0:X2}", b); 74 } 75 ret.ToString(); 76 return ret.ToString(); 77 78 79 } 80 81 ///MD5解密 82 public static string DecryptMD5(string pToDecrypt) 83 { 84 DESCryptoServiceProvider des = new DESCryptoServiceProvider(); 85 86 byte[] inputByteArray = new byte[pToDecrypt.Length / 2]; 87 for (int x = 0; x < pToDecrypt.Length / 2; x++) 88 { 89 int i = (Convert.ToInt32(pToDecrypt.Substring(x * 2, 2), 16)); 90 inputByteArray[x] = (byte)i; 91 } 92 93 des.Key = ASCIIEncoding.ASCII.GetBytes(_MD5_Key); 94 des.IV = ASCIIEncoding.ASCII.GetBytes(_MD5_Key); 95 MemoryStream ms = new MemoryStream(); 96 CryptoStream cs = new CryptoStream(ms, des.CreateDecryptor(), CryptoStreamMode.Write); 97 cs.Write(inputByteArray, 0, inputByteArray.Length); 98 cs.FlushFinalBlock(); 99 100 StringBuilder ret = new StringBuilder(); 101 102 return System.Text.Encoding.Default.GetString(ms.ToArray()); 103 } 104 105 /// <summary> 106 /// 使用HASH算法加密, 无法解密 107 /// </summary> 108 /// <param name="key"></param> 109 /// <returns></returns> 110 public static string DecryptHASH(string value) 111 { 112 byte[] StrRes = Encoding.Default.GetBytes(value); 113 HashAlgorithm iSHA = new SHA1CryptoServiceProvider(); 114 StrRes = iSHA.ComputeHash(StrRes); 115 StringBuilder EnText = new StringBuilder(); 116 foreach (byte iByte in StrRes) 117 { 118 EnText.AppendFormat("{0:x2}", iByte); 119 } 120 return EnText.ToString(); 121 } 122 123 /// <summary> 124 /// 加密 125 /// </summary> 126 /// <param name="encryptString"></param> 127 /// <returns></returns> 128 public static string Base64Encode(string encryptString) 129 { 130 byte[] encbuff = System.Text.Encoding.UTF8.GetBytes(encryptString); 131 return Convert.ToBase64String(encbuff); 132 } 133 /// <summary> 134 /// 解密 135 /// </summary> 136 /// <param name="decryptString"></param> 137 /// <returns></returns> 138 public static string Base64Decode(string decryptString) 139 { 140 byte[] decbuff = Convert.FromBase64String(decryptString); 141 return System.Text.Encoding.UTF8.GetString(decbuff); 142 } 143 }
